As was stated one round on Saturday due to a having to move the course over. There was a bad spin that may have tore the course up pretty good. I think there is video of it on the Scta website. Sunday there was an issue with the ambulance and once that was taken care of the wind picked up and the meet was cancelled.

Bob Moreland won the overall points championship by putting 30+ mph on the existing record amd John Noonan was the number one bike by putting 25 mph on the existing sidecar record. Congrats to all for a great year and thanks to all of you that have helped me this year and welcomed me to the SDRC!


493 H      BGRMR   Moreland Noonan Lux SDRC Bob Moreland 174.588 141.428
854B   1350CC SC-BG   Noonan / Moreland SDRC John Noonan 212.967 187.251

Way to go SDRC, Moreland and Noonan!

We were about 8 cars back on Saturday when the 372 Car had a violent spin went airborne at the finish line and took out the right side of the course. Someone described it as a "spin and sway meet" - "car parts all over the place. Driver OK but car had suspension and wheel damage. This is second hand info.

The line steward warned all the drives to stay to the left, or left center. I was the next car to run when the Sundowner Corvette spun on the left side. After it was cleared, Jim Jensen came up to cinch the belts and said that now the right side was better than the left. Well that left only the center that had been hard on all day. Well so much for having a high starting#. Hit a soft spot about 2/3rd's down and had to lift.

How can you have so much FUN and FRUSTRATION all at the same time?  That's El Mirage!
